                                                      Originally posted by SBR_John
                                                      If you honestly believe that there is no value on a +12.5 -115 line when the market is +10 -110, you should find a new hobby.
                                                      john i think thaddeus meant there wasn't a heck of a lot of value in taking both sides - you get criticized because your old offers were even better!

                                                      sbr odds calculator tells me in ncaaf on a 10 point -110 spread the +12.5 should be -137 and the -9 1/2 should be -119.
                                                      backing out the -115 juice on each side this is still a small advantage.

                                                      i thank you for the offer, and i think i will be playing texas for the maximum.

                                                            Originally posted by SBR_John
                                                            If you honestly believe that there is no value on a +12.5 -115 line when the market is +10 -110, you should find a new hobby.
                                                            I didn't say no value, I said much value. But yah, I messed up originally as I had it at about 1.5% value when its more like 5%. (I forgot to include half the value of 10.) 5% is good value and well worth taking.

                                                            Thaddeus

                                                            P.S. I would gladly take 1.5% value too. I was just saying with a small value like that it is better to wait and see... Even now it is probably still better to wait and see because if the line moves to 10.5, then -9.5 is the better deal.
